Décor Breakdown
Style & Mood
To create your modern cozy retreat, aim for a balance between sleek lines and inviting textures. Think contemporary styles infused with rustic charm. Incorporate elements like soft fabrics, curated art pieces, and natural materials. This fusion not only fosters comfort but also elevates your home’s visual appeal, making it a soothing spot to unwind after a busy day.
Color Palette
Selecting the right colors sets the foundation for your cozy space. Opt for neutral tones such as soft beiges, warm whites, and gentle greys as your base. Infuse accents of earthy colors like moss green, terracotta, or muted blues to evoke a sense of nature. This palette promotes relaxation and creates an inviting backdrop for personal touches.
Key Furniture & Décor Elements
When choosing furniture, consider pieces that offer both style and comfort. Here are a few essentials:
- Plush Sofa: A sectional or oversized sofa with soft cushions can become the focal point of the room. Look for fabrics that feel cozy and warm.
- Layered Rugs: Start with a larger neutral rug and layer it with smaller textured rugs to add depth and warmth.
- Wooden Accents: Incorporate natural wood through furniture like coffee tables or side tables. This adds warmth and connects the space to nature.
- Gallery Wall: Create a personal touch with a selection of framed photos, art prints, and even mirrors to visually enlarge the space.
Lighting & Textures
Lighting plays a pivotal role in setting the mood. Soft, diffused lighting creates warmth—consider using a mix of table lamps, floor lamps, and ceiling fixtures with dimmable features. Incorporate various textures, such as knitted throws, velvet cushions, or wicker baskets to add visual interest and comfort.
5–7 Practical Home Décor Tips
- Mix Materials: Combine wood, metal, and fabric for an eclectic yet cohesive look.
- Personal Touches: Add decorative items that reflect your personality—such as books, family heirlooms, or travel souvenirs.
- Incorporate Greenery: Use plants or flowers to bring life into your space. They purify air and add color.
- Seasonal Accents: Switch out small décor pieces and cushions seasonally to reflect changing times of the year, bringing freshness to your décor.
- Optimize Space: Use multifunctional furniture, such as an ottoman with storage, to maximize smaller spaces without clutter.
- Layer Lighting: Combine ambient, task, and accent lighting to create a dynamic atmosphere.
- Choose Comfortable Textiles: Opt for soft fabric options for curtains and cushions that invite you to relax.
Budget-Friendly Alternatives
Creating a cozy home doesn’t require a hefty budget. Here are some alternatives to consider:
- DIY Art: Instead of buying expensive artwork, create your own pieces inspired by your favorite colors or themes.
- Thrift Shop Finds: Visit thrift stores for unique furniture or accessories that can be refreshed with a simple coat of paint or new upholstery.
- Swap Accessories: Refresh your space by periodically swapping existing décor items from other rooms in your home.
How to Recreate This Look at Home
- Start with a Clean Slate: Clear out clutter and evaluate your space. This step maximizes both aesthetics and livability.
- Choose a Color Palette: Decide on your main colors and accents. This will guide your furniture and décor purchases.
- Invest Wisely: Focus on a few key furniture pieces that are durable and stylish. Mix in affordable accessories to enhance the look.
- Layer Textures: After adding furniture, fill in with textiles and accessories that create comfort and warmth—think throws, pillows, and rugs.
